Medumba and French apertium-byv-fra =============================================================================== This is an Apertium language pair for translating between Medumba and French. What you can use this language package for: * Translating between Medumba and French * Morphological analysis of Medumba and French * Part-of-speech tagging of Medumba and French For information on the latter two points, see subheading "For more information" below Requirements =============================================================================== You will need the following software installed: * lttoolbox (>= 3.3.0) * apertium (>= 3.3.0) * vislcg3 (>= 0.9.9.10297) * hfst (>= 3.8.2) * apertium-byv * apertium-fra If this does not make any sense, we recommend you look at: apertium.org Compiling =============================================================================== Given the requirements being installed, you should be able to just run: $ ./configure $ make # make install You can use ./autogen.sh instead of ./configure you're compiling from SVN. If you installed any prerequisite language packages using a --prefix to ./configure, make sure to give the same --prefix to ./configure here.
